Adults who lack confidence with maths can explore what maths anxiety is, the signs to look for and how to overcome it. This workshop is a 2-hour session, face to face in small classes. It’s ideal if you want help to break down barriers to learning maths, build your confidence, revisit maths after a long break or simply want support in using maths in everyday life at home. We make maths fun and relatable to your life, designed especially for you, with tutors who understand your needs.

Find out what qualifications and skills you will need for this course.

There are no qualifications required to join this course, just a willingness to learn and lots of enthusiasm. This course is for learners who do not have maths GCSE at grade C/4 or above, or any equivalent. If you do have maths GCSE at grade C/4 or above – or any equivalent, please call us on 0330 332 7997.
